Default Does TELUS' "Unlimited Mobile Browsing" really mean unlimited?

I just got the Student 35 plan at Telus, and it comes with "Unlimited web browsing". The note at the bottom of the page with the subscript says - "Unlimited Web browsing applies to PCS phones only and applies to usage within the phone's Web browser. Tethered usage is not included. Downloads and application fees are charged separately where applicable. Web browsing is only available on digital phones in TELUS digital service area."

Does this mean that as long as I stay away from Youtube and other downloading data sites, then I'll be perfectly fine and not have any overusage? Or do pictures on a site count as something they can charge as a download?

Finally, I don't see any restrictions as to what sites I can visit. Does that mean I'm in the clear?
